Based on work from Florent Drouin, split the 32-bit link-layer type
field in a capture file into: a 16-bit link-layer type field (it's 16 bits in pcap-NG, and that'll probably be enough for the foreseeable future); a 10-bit "class" field, indicating the group of link-layer type values to which the link-layer type belongs - class 0 is for regular DLT_ values, and class 0x224 grandfathers in the NetBSD "raw address family" link-layer types; a 6-bit "extension" field, storing information about the capture, such an indication of whether the packets include an FCS and, if so, how many bytes of FCS are present.
